From: Jack Lange Date: Tue, 4 May 2010 03:28:27 +0000 (-0500) Subject: build system fixes X-Git-Url: http://v3vee.org/palacios/gitweb/gitweb.cgi?p=palacios.git;a=commitdiff_plain;h=2fa62a8319b951b761c235bde156e1eeacce996a build system fixes --- diff --git a/Makefile b/Makefile index a08ed20..bb5c155 100644 --- a/Makefile +++ b/Makefile @@ -682,6 +682,9 @@ MRPROPER_FILES += .config .config.old .version .old_version \ tags TAGS cscope* +# \( -name '*.[oas]' -o -name '*.ko' -o -name '.*.cmd' \ + + # clean - Delete most, but leave enough to build external modules # clean: rm-dirs := $(CLEAN_DIRS) @@ -693,7 +696,6 @@ $(clean-dirs): $(Q)$(MAKE) $(clean)=$(patsubst _clean_%,%,$@) -# \( -name '*.[oas]' -o -name '*.ko' -o -name '.*.cmd' \ clean: archclean $(clean-dirs) $(call cmd,rmdirs) $(call cmd,rmfiles) diff --git a/modules/Makefile b/modules/Makefile index f5455c5..eef66e0 100644 --- a/modules/Makefile +++ b/modules/Makefile @@ -1,3 +1,4 @@ +obj-y += null.c obj-$(CONFIG_LNX_MOD_32BIT) += linux_mods/i386/ #obj-$(CONFIG_LNX_MOD_64BIT) += linux_mods/x86_64/ obj-$(CONFIG_V3_MOD_32BIT) += v3_mods/i386/ diff --git a/modules/null.c b/modules/null.c new file mode 100644 index 0000000..1828c44 --- /dev/null +++ b/modules/null.c @@ -0,0 +1,6 @@ +/** \file + * Do nothing module. + * + * This file only exists to appease the kbuild gods. + */ +